bool CSSTokenizer::nextCharsAreIdentifier()
{
    UChar first = consume();
    bool areIdentifier = nextCharsAreIdentifier(first);
    reconsume(first);
    return areIdentifier;
}
CSSParserToken CSSTokenizer::commercialAt(UChar cc)
{
    ASSERT(cc == '@');
    if (nextCharsAreIdentifier())
        return CSSParserToken(AtKeywordToken, consumeName());
    return CSSParserToken(DelimiterToken, '@');
}
// http://www.w3.org/TR/css3-syntax/#consume-a-numeric-token
CSSParserToken CSSTokenizer::consumeNumericToken()
{
    CSSParserToken token = consumeNumber();
    if (nextCharsAreIdentifier())
        token.convertToDimensionWithUnit(consumeName());
    else if (consumeIfNext('%'))
        token.convertToPercentage();
    return token;
}
CSSParserToken CSSTokenizer::hash(UChar cc)
{
    UChar nextChar = m_input.nextInputChar();
    if (isNameChar(nextChar) || twoCharsAreValidEscape(nextChar, m_input.peek(1))) {
        HashTokenType type = nextCharsAreIdentifier() ? HashTokenId : HashTokenUnrestricted;
        return CSSParserToken(type, consumeName());
    }

    return CSSParserToken(DelimiterToken, cc);
}

CSSParserToken CSSTokenizer::hyphenMinus(UChar cc)
{
    if (nextCharsAreNumber(cc)) {
        reconsume(cc);
        return consumeNumericToken();
    }
    if (m_input.peek(0) == '-' && m_input.peek(1) == '>') {
        consume(2);
        return CSSParserToken(CDCToken);
    }
    if (nextCharsAreIdentifier(cc)) {
        reconsume(cc);
        return consumeIdentLikeToken();
    }
    return CSSParserToken(DelimiterToken, cc);
}
